What to know about ACU, HSU and McMurry graduate ceremonies

Graduation season is happening throughout May, and three colleges in Abilene are first to walk the stage this weekend.

Abilene Christian University, McMurry University and Hardin-Simmons University are hosting commencements on Friday and Saturday.

Abilene Christian University

Abilene Christian University will award 840 degrees throughout three ceremonies this weekend. During the Friday ceremony, 246 masters and 53 doctoral degrees will be awarded. During Saturday's two graduation ceremonies, 541 bachelor's degrees will be presented.

The master's and doctoral commencement ceremony is scheduled for 7 p.m. Friday at Moody Coliseum on the ACU campus. Attendees will hear from Dr. Christopher W. Cobbler Sr., executive director of the Center for Vocational Formation and dean of vocational formation at ACU Dallas.

Undergraduates from the College of Arts, Humanities and Social Sciences, the College of Biblical Studies and the Onstead College of Science and Engineering will graduate at 10 a.m. Saturday at Moody Coliseum.

The ceremony for undergraduates from the College of Business Administration, the College of Graduate and Professional Studies and the College of Health and Behavioral Sciences will start at 2 p.m. Saturday at Moody Coliseum.

The address for both Saturday ceremonies will be done by Michael Miller, ACU 1999 alumnus and senior pastor of UPPERROOM.

All three ceremonies will be livestreamed online, including the undergraduate ceremonies and the graduate ceremony.

McMurry University

McMurry University's baccalaureate ceremony will be 5:30 p.m. Friday in the Radford Auditorium. Students graduating with University Honors will receive their honor's hood and four graduating senior awards will be presented.

McMurry University's May 2024 Commencement is scheduled for 10 a.m. Saturday at Kimbrell Arena, 2249 Sayles Boulevard, in the J.W. Hunt Physical Education Center.

Two honorary doctorate recipients, one master's degree recipient and 117 bachelor's degree recipients will be awarded during the ceremony.

The university's first eight graduates of the McMurry Dual Credit Academy will receive associate degrees.

Hardin-Simmons University

Hardin-Simmons University will host its two spring commencement ceremonies at Abilene Convention Center, 1100 North Sixth Street, on Friday.

Graduates from the College of Health Professionals, Holland School of Sciences and Mathematics and Patty Hanks Shelton School of Nursing will graduate Friday morning at 10 a.m.

Students graduating from the Cynthia Ann Parker College of Liberal Arts and Kelley College of Business and Professional Studies will graduate 2 p.m. Friday afternoon.

During the morning ceremony, graduates will hear from Congressman Roger Williams, U.S. representative for the 25th Congressional District. Graduates in the afternoon ceremony will hear an address from Dr. Larry McGraw, associate dean of the Cynthia Ann Parker College of Liberal Arts.

Those unable to attend in person can view livestreams of the morning and afternoon commencements on the Hardin-Simmons YouTube page.
